Indiana Cost of Living

Fishers, Indiana is a great place to live for those who want an affordable cost of living. In Indiana, the cost of living is nearly 10% below the national average. This means that your dollar will go further in Indiana than in other parts of the country.

Housing costs are a big part of the reason why the cost of living is so low in Indiana. The median home price in Indiana is just $101,000, which is much lower than the national median home price of $184,700. Rent prices are also relatively affordable in Indiana, with the average two-bedroom apartment renting for $850 per month.

If you're looking for an affordable place to live, Fishers is definitely worth considering. Just be sure to research the job market in your desired area so you can make sure you'll be able to find employment.

Where to Move in Indiana

Need help choosing where to live in Indiana? Here is a breakdown of the best cities to live in the state:

  1. Carmel – This is a town with a dense suburban feel and is home to less than 100,000 people. Most residents are homeowners and it has a highly-rated public school system.
  2. Fishers – This city is clean with a high quality of living.
  3. Zionsville – It is family-friendly with good schools. This community is also safe with a low crime rate.
  4. Granger – This suburb is one of the best places to live for families in Indiana. It has many parks and restaurants along with other family-friendly attractions.
  5. Westfield – This is another low-crime area in Indiana with great economic and ethnic diversity.
